Marilyn B. (Davis) Rivers

August 5, 1930 — May 10, 2021

A Funeral Service will be held at 12:00 (Noon) on Thursday, May 20 in the Brandon Funeral Home, 305 Wanoosnoc Rd., Fitchburg. A visitation period will be from 10:00 – 12:00 prior to the service. Burial will be in the Forest Hill Cemetery in Fitchburg.



Fitchburg- Marilyn B. (Davis) (Turner) Rivers, 90, passed away on Monday, May 10 in the Heywood Hospital in Gardner surrounded by her children.

Marilyn was born on August 5, 1930 in Fitchburg a daughter of Walter and Gertrude (Johnson) Davis.

She is survived by her children, John Turner and his partner, Mary-Ann Macaione of Peabody, Lynn (Turner) Hebert and her husband, Thomas of Winchendon, Donna (Turner) Arsenault and her husband, James of Hubbardston, Brian Rivers, David Rivers, Eric Rivers all of Fitchburg, stepchildren, Norma (Rivers) Seney and her husband, George of Sebastian, Florida, Mary (Rivers) Cornacchioli and her husband, Louis of Rutland, daughter in law, Carolyn Rivers of Leominster, sister, Gail Ferguson of Lunenburg, grandchildren, Daniel Hebert of Greenville, NH, Christopher Hebert of Winchendon, and 4 great-grandchildren.

She is predeceased by her husband, Lauri Rivers and her first husband, John W. Turner, her sister, Lucille Sanders, and her stepson, Norman Rivers.

Mrs. Rivers spent many years as a healthcare worker in hospitals, nursing homes and most recently at Leominster Crossings Assisted Living where she received awards and countless thank you letters from grateful family members of those in her care. She was also the owner and President of the former Turner Motor Coach Inc. in Fitchburg.

Marilyn enjoyed cooking, hosting family gatherings, scenic drives and vacationing at Cape Cod.
